Chrome Extensions Using Python

The idea is to compile Python to Javascript (technically a JS pre-compiler) using Rapydscript. Then include the generated script in the Chrome extension. The site above has a zip file with all the stuff inside.
I recommend using Rapydscript instead of Pyjamas. A Python script compiled with Rapydscript works like any other Chrome plugin.
Pyjamas scripts does not work well with Google Chrome (needs a special parameter when Chrome starts or server).
